I did another play thru and confirmed that for sure its one pool (I think the total is around 700 scrap). Best way to harvest scrap is to leave most sectors UN-explored until you get the 'cursed fragment" at the comet- then purchase a pair of scrap processors -AND- get the high roller fragment. Then you can get 2 or 3 scrap for every sector you pass thru. Helps to have a stealth ship, and a fast warp charge.
